Daniel Daian is a renowned Romanian poet and novelist. He is born in Deva, Romania on Nov. 29, 1978. His poems have been published in many international magazines and anthologies, and he is the author of the following collections: Crystal Trees (Ed. Rovimed Publishers), Bacău (2011, poetry, Ed. Metaphysical Anxieties), Reflections from Prison Angels ( Ed. Metaphysical Anxieties, Constanta, 2011, prose); Round Scream (Ed. Grinta, Cluj-Napoca, 2012, poetry); The Last God,, (Ed. Rovimed Publishers, Bacău, 2013, theatre); The Diary of the Forty-four Minutes From When I Am Alive, (Ed. Rovimed Publishers, Bacău, 2013, poetry).
Translator: Daniela Voicu is a Romanian poet, novelist and painter. She has collections of poems published: Poems of Angels (2006), Blue in Vitro ( 2012), Surfing Silence (2012), and Windows without dreams (E-book 2012) In 2009, she founded the international journal of culture and literature, Cuib Nest Nido; and in 2011 she founded the international poetry festival of music and contemporary art, "The Art to be Human in Switzerland." Since 2009, she has been a member of the Writers' League of Romania.
